This one is absolutely gorgeous — a beautifully illustrated pattern puzzle packed with nods to Britain's most iconic royal palaces. Palace Stories is produced in association with Historic Royal Palaces, and every inch of this design is filled with Tudor-era figures, grand palace facades, strawberries, swords, blooms, and trailing botanical foliage in the most wonderful mix of deep purples, pinks, reds, and mint greens.
It's the kind of puzzle where you keep noticing new details the longer you look — a courtly figure here, a topiary tree there, and those oversized strawberries dotted throughout that give it such a playful, folk-art charm. The white background helps you sort and place pieces, but the sheer variety of illustrated elements will keep you thoroughly entertained throughout the build.
1,000 pieces and made by House of Puzzles, this would make a brilliant gift for anyone who loves British history, royal heritage, or simply a beautiful, characterful puzzle to display once complete.
The white background aids sorting, but the dense mix of similarly scaled illustrated motifs — florals, figures, buildings, and foliage — spread evenly across the image creates plenty of tricky mid-build moments.
